Varieties of D-Sub Connectors

The diverse range of plastic cover for d sub 78 connector available today caters to a multitude of requirements across different sectors. Common types include standard D-Sub connectors, high-density D-Sub connectors, and mixed layout D-Sub connectors. Standard D-Sub connectors are widely used for their robust design and ease of use, featuring a typical pin count ranging from 9 to 50. High-density D-Sub connectors, on the other hand, offer a greater number of pins within the same shell size, making them ideal for applications where space is at a premium. Mixed layout D-Sub connectors combine power and signal contacts within a single unit, providing a versatile solution for complex systems. Materials and Construction

The construction of plastic cover for d sub 78 connector involves meticulous attention to material selection and design to ensure optimal performance. Typically, the connectors are made from durable metals such as brass or phosphor bronze, which are plated with nickel or gold to enhance conductivity and resistance to corrosion. The insulator materials, often made from high-grade thermoplastics, provide excellent dielectric properties and mechanical stability. Understanding Connector Specifications

The specifications of plastic cover for d sub 78 connector are essential in determining their suitability for particular applications. Key parameters include the current rating, voltage rating, and contact resistance, which influence the connector's ability to transmit power and signals effectively. The insulator resistance and dielectric strength are critical for maintaining signal integrity and preventing electrical failures. Additionally, the mating cycles, which indicate the connector's durability and lifespan, should be considered, especially in applications involving frequent connections and disconnections.
